Graduation Requirements

Courses required for high school graduation:

(22 units of credit are required for a Guilderland High School Diploma)

English – 4.0 Credits
Social Studies – 4.0 Credits
Math – 3.0 Credits
Science – 3.0 Credits
Language – 1.0 Credit
Health – 0.5 Credit
The Arts – 1.0 Credit
Phys. Ed – 2.0 Credits
Electives – 3.5 Credits
Total: 22 Credits

Diploma type is determined by passing the following New York State assessments:

Regents Diploma:

Minimum score of 65 required on all exams.

  • 1 Math Regents exam
  • 1 Science Regents exam
  • 1 Social Studies Regents exam
  • 1 English Regents exam
    AND at least one of the following:

    • Humanities Pathway: A minimum score of 65 on a second Social Studies Regents exam or state-approved alternative.
    • STEM (Science, Technology, Engineering & Math) Pathway: A minimum score of 65 on a second Science Regents exam or a minimum score of 65 on a second Math Regents exam or a state-approved alternative.
    • Bi-literacy/Language other than English (LOTE) Pathway: Completion of a LOTE sequence and state-approved LOTE assessment.
    • Career & Technical Education (CTE) Pathway: Completion of a state-approved CTE program and state-approved assessment.
    • Arts Pathway: Completion of an arts sequence and state-approved arts assessment (This assessment has yet to be determined at this time).
    • Career Development Occupational Studies (CDOS) Pathway:  Completion of 216 hours of CTE coursework including 54 hours of work-based-learning as well as a completed career plan and employability profile.

Regents with Advanced Designation Diploma:

Follow the Humanities Pathway plus the additional tests listed below, with a minimum score of 65 required:

  • 2 additional Math Regents exams
  • 1 additional Science Regents exam
  • 3-4 credits in World Languages & Cultures and a minimum score of 65 on Checkpoint B exam OR a 5-credit sequence in Art & Design, Music, Business, Technology, or Career & Technical Education (CTE).
